Five changes happening in essential services and rules from June 1, know about them 1

New Delhi. From June 1, many changes are taking place in the services and rules related to your daily needs. First thing about Employees Provident Fund. EPFO is going to make it mandatory to link PF account with Aadhaar. At the same time, the website of the Income Tax Department will not work from June 1 to June 6. Keeping in mind the convenience of the taxpayers, a new website is being launched for filing returns.

Changes will affect life

1- Linking PF account with Aadhaar will now be necessary-
Employees’ Provident Fund Organization has given instructions to employers regarding PF that after June 1, if an account is not linked with Aadhaar or UNS Aadhaar is not verified, then its electronic challan cum return will not be filed.

2- Income Tax Department will launch new website-
The Income Tax Department is going to launch a new website to provide better facilities to the taxpayers. For this, the website of Income Tax Department will be closed from June 1 to 6. The new portal e-filing 2.0 will start on 7th June for filing returns.

3- More tax on earning from YouTube-
You may have to pay tax on the earnings from YouTube. This new tax policy of YouTube will start from June 2021. Indian YouTube content creators will also come under the ambit of this tax, who will have to pay 24 percent tax.

4- Traveling by domestic air will now be expensive-
There has been an increase of 13 to 16 percent in the fares of different duration aircraft. The minimum fare for a distance of 40 minutes has been raised from Rs 2,300 to Rs 2,600. At the same time, the fare for 60 minutes flight will be Rs 3,300 instead of 2,900.

5- The rule of payment by check in BOB will change-
Bank of Baroda (BOB) is going to change the rules of check payment of the bank from June 1. The bank is implementing Positive Pay Confirmation. Customers will have to get confirmed on check payment of more than two lakhs. Information has to be given in advance.
